Matching Church, officially known as St Mary the Virgin, is a historic Church of England parish church nestled in the picturesque village of Matching, within the Epping Forest district of Essex, England. Standing at an elevation of 74 metres, this Grade II* listed building is a significant local landmark, serving the communities of Matching, Matching Green, and Matching Tye.     Ofte stillede spørgsmål

    Where can visitors park when visiting Matching Church?

    While the immediate approach road to Matching Church is a paved bridleway with no direct motor vehicle access, visitors can typically find parking in the village of Matching or near Matching Green. It's advisable to look for designated public parking areas or park considerately on village roads, ensuring no obstructions to local residents or traffic flow.

    What is the typical terrain and difficulty level of trails around Matching Church?

    The terrain around Matching Church is predominantly flat or gently undulating, characteristic of the Essex countryside. Many paths, including the bridleway to the church, are paved or well-maintained dirt tracks. This makes most routes suitable for walkers, cyclists, and trail runners of varying abilities, generally falling into the easy to intermediate difficulty categories.
